Quarterly Planning Note — Pilot Churn, Lanterbrook Analytics. The Fernway pilot lost 11 of 40 accounts this quarter, mostly at contract renewal. Root cause: onboarding gaps, not product fit. Remediation plan funded; next review in eight weeks. The board should weigh this against the note that follows.

management briefing: Project Ulavan slips by two quarters because of the staffing delay.

Handover — Widediff large-file viewer

For the security reviewer: Widediff streams files over 200 MB in chunked windows; rendering never loads full content into memory. Known gaps: path normalization on archive entries, and the temp-file cleanup on crash. Fuzz corpus lives in the sealed bucket. Audit logs are encrypted at rest. To open the sealed audit archive, enter the recovery passphrase provided below.

strongbox words: alddor-rusius-belox-gorys-holius-oliix-ralmir-lamvan-briius-fraion-zormir-novwyn-zormir-holmir

## RateLens Environments

RateLens, the rate-parity checker built by Quillhaven Systems, runs in three environments: sandbox, staging, and production. Plugin authors should target sandbox first, since it polls synthetic hotel rate feeds and never touches live distributor data. Staging mirrors production scheduling but throttles crawl frequency, so parity alerts may lag. Each environment exposes its own comparison thresholds and polling intervals. The effective configuration for the sandbox environment is listed below.

config for kafof-bawef:
holath:
  log_level: debug
  metrics_host: metrics.holath.qorvelsys.internal
  pin: 2191
  pool_size: 32

## Support

The PayLattice integration suite occasionally fails on the settlement-batch tests due to clock skew in the sandbox ledger. A single rerun usually clears it; three consecutive failures indicate a real regression and should block the release. Rerun instructions are in the pipeline README. For triage help or to request a sandbox reset, write to us here.

escalation mailbox, bafog-fafog: ulador@paliqlabs.internal